The term ‘crypto’ originates from the Greek word ‘kryptos,’ meaning hidden or secret. This reflects its roots in cryptography, which involves methods of securing information to maintain privacy and integrity. Components of Cryptography

Cryptography is built upon several key components that work together to secure information and transactions. Understanding these components is essential for anyone interested in crypto technology.

  • Encryption: This process transforms readable information into a coded format, making it unreadable to unauthorized users. Only those with the correct decryption key can convert it back to its original form.
  • Decryption: The reverse of encryption, decryption is the method used to convert encrypted data back to its readable form. It is crucial for ensuring that only authorized parties can access sensitive information.
  • Hashing: A vital component of blockchain technology, hashing converts information into a fixed-size string of characters. This process ensures data integrity and is essential for validating transactions in cryptocurrencies.

Understanding Bitcoin RBF

Replace-by-Fee (RBF) is a feature that allows Bitcoin users to modify the transaction fee of an unconfirmed Bitcoin transaction. This capability plays an essential role in ensuring that transactions are processed in a timely manner, especially during periods of high network congestion. RBF is significant because it provides users with the flexibility to adjust fees dynamically, which can be crucial for receiving confirmations quickly.RBF operates within the Bitcoin network by allowing users to broadcast a new transaction with a higher fee to replace an existing one that has not yet been confirmed.

When a transaction is flagged for RBF, miners can choose to prioritize the new transaction based on the higher fee offered. This means that users can avoid lengthy waiting periods for their transactions to clear, especially in a busy network environment. For example, if someone sends a Bitcoin payment and realizes their fee is too low due to sudden spikes in network traffic, they can opt for RBF to ensure their transaction is processed faster.

Mechanism of Replace-by-Fee

The process of how RBF allows for fee modification is relatively straightforward. Initially, when a user creates a Bitcoin transaction, they can mark it as RBF-enabled. If the transaction becomes unconfirmed, the user can then create a new version of that transaction with a higher fee. The Bitcoin network recognizes this new transaction as a replacement, and miners can opt to include it in the next block.There are two types of RBF: full RBF and opt-in RBF.

Full RBF enables any unconfirmed transaction to be replaced with a higher fee, while opt-in RBF requires the sender to explicitly indicate their intention for the transaction to be replaceable. For users looking to employ RBF, the typical steps include:

  1. Create an initial transaction and enable RBF.
  2. Submit the transaction to the Bitcoin network.
  3. Monitor the transaction for confirmation.
  4. If unconfirmed, create a replacement transaction with a higher fee.
  5. Broadcast the replacement transaction.

Challenges and Limitations of RBF

Implementing RBF comes with potential risks. One of the primary concerns is that malicious actors could exploit the feature to double-spend coins, although this is mitigated by the need for miner validation. Moreover, RBF may not be suitable for all transaction contexts, especially in cases where users require absolute finality.Common misconceptions about RBF often include the belief that it automatically guarantees faster transaction times, which is not always the case.

Each transaction still relies on miner willingness to prioritize replacements. Here’s a list clarifying some of these misconceptions:

  • RBF guarantees confirmation: It merely increases the likelihood but does not guarantee.
  • All wallets support RBF: Not all wallets have RBF enabled by default or at all.
  • RBF is complicated: Most modern wallets simplify the RBF process.

Bitcoin Wallets Explained

A Bitcoin wallet serves as a digital tool that allows users to store and manage their Bitcoin securely. Understanding different types of wallets and their features is crucial for anyone looking to engage with cryptocurrencies. With various options available, users can choose wallets suited to their needs, whether for everyday transactions or long-term holding.Bitcoin wallets can be categorized primarily into two types: hot wallets and cold wallets.

Both serve the same purpose of storing Bitcoin, but they differ significantly in terms of convenience and security. Hot wallets are connected to the internet, which makes them more accessible for transactions but also more vulnerable to hacks. In contrast, cold wallets are offline storage solutions that provide a higher level of security, protecting users from online threats.

Global Regulatory Landscape of Bitcoin

The global regulatory landscape for Bitcoin applications is characterized by a patchwork of laws and guidelines. Countries like the United States, the European Union, Japan, and China have established distinct regulatory frameworks that reflect their economic priorities and cultural attitudes towards cryptocurrencies.

United States

In the U.S., regulatory bodies such as the Securities and Exchange Commission (SEC) and the Financial Crimes Enforcement Network (FinCEN) oversee cryptocurrency transactions. States like Wyoming have passed favorable laws to promote blockchain innovation, while others impose stricter regulations.

European Union

The EU is working on the Markets in Crypto-Assets Regulation (MiCA), aiming to create a cohesive regulatory environment across member states. This includes defining the legal status of cryptocurrencies and establishing compliance measures for businesses.

Japan

Japan has embraced cryptocurrencies with a clear regulatory framework, requiring exchanges to register with the Financial Services Agency (FSA) and comply with anti-money laundering (AML) laws.

China

On the other hand, China has enacted a strict ban on cryptocurrency trading and initial coin offerings (ICOs), focusing instead on the development of a state-backed digital currency. Each of these approaches illustrates how Bitcoin’s regulatory environment can influence its adoption and use in different markets.

Compliance Measures for Businesses Using Bitcoin

Businesses engaging with Bitcoin must adhere to various compliance measures to ensure legal operation. These measures often include:

Know Your Customer (KYC)

Companies must verify the identity of their clients to mitigate the risk of fraud and money laundering. This involves collecting personal information, including names, addresses, and identification documents.

Anti-Money Laundering (AML)

Businesses must implement procedures to detect and report suspicious transactions, ensuring they comply with AML regulations designed to prevent financial crimes.

Tax Compliance

Companies must be aware of the tax implications of Bitcoin transactions in their jurisdictions. This includes reporting income from Bitcoin trading and understanding capital gains tax obligations.

Data Security Standards

Given the high value and volatility of Bitcoin, businesses must adopt robust cybersecurity measures to protect their digital assets from theft or hacking attempts.
